What to Expect

JOLIETTE Petit Manseng offers a delightful journey through sweet and dry wine experiences from southwest France. This grape variety, known for its vivid acidity and tropical fruit flavors, is particularly suited for dessert or fortified wines like port and sherry. Its small berries and thick skins allow it to hang on the vine late into harvest, developing high sugar levels while maintaining striking acidity, making it a versatile choice for both dry and sweet wine enthusiasts. Expect notes of pineapple, mango, apricot, citrus peel, honey, ginger, and white flowers in your glass, with each sip revealing a complex interplay between sweetness and acidity that pairs beautifully with spicy dishes, foie gras-style preparations, blue cheese, roast pork, tropical fruit desserts, and more.
